单词 | touch¹ |
释义 | touch¹ /tʌtʃ; tʌtʃ/v 1. [t] to put your hand or finger on something [用手或手指]触摸,碰:◇don't touch the paint — it's still wet! 别碰油漆 — 还没干!◇she touched his forehead gently. 她轻轻地碰碰他的额头。 2. [i,t] if two things are touching, there is no space in between them 碰到,触着,贴着:◇make sure the wires aren't touching. 确保电线没有碰在一起。 3. not touch sth a) to not use, eat, or drink something 不使用[吃、饮][某物]:◇he never touches a drop of alcohol. 他一向滴酒不沾。 b) to not deal with or become involved in something 不处理[涉及]某事:◇clancy said he wouldn't touch the case. 克兰西说他不会管那个案子。 4. not touch sb/sth to not hurt someone or damage something 不伤害某人/不损坏某物:◇i swear i didn't touch him! 我发誓没有碰过他! 5. [t] to affect someone's emotions, especially by making them feel pity or sympathy 触动,感动:◇chaplin's films touched the hearts of millions. 卓别灵的电影打动了无数人。 6. touch base ame to talk to someone for a short time, especially about something you are both working on 【美】 [与某人]简略地谈谈 7. no one to touch sb/nothing to touch sth spoken used to say that someone or something is the best 【口】 没有一个人能比得上某人/没有一样东西能比得上某物:◇a brilliant player! there's no one to touch her. 有才气的演奏者! 没有一个人能比得上她。 8. touch wood bre spoken something you say when you do not want your good luck to end 【英口】摸摸木头愿好运常在; knock on wood ame 【美】→ see also 另见 touchedtouch downif a plane touches down, it lands on the ground at an airport [飞机]着陆,降落touch sth ↔ offto make people start arguing or fighting with each other 触发,引起[争吵或打斗]:◇the report touched off a fierce debate. 那报道引起了一场激烈的辩论。touch on/upon sthto mention something when you are talking or writing [讲话或写作时]提到,提及touch sth ↔ upto improve something by making small changes to it 修改,修饰 |
